The most stylish stars in the worlds of music, film and fashion turned out for this year's technology-themed Met Gala.

Beyoncé, Taylor Swift, Kim Kardashian and Gigi Hadid were among the A-listers who embraced the futuristic theme for Sunday night's party held at the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York.

Hosted by Vogue editor Anna Wintour, Swift, Idris Elba and Apple's Chief Design Officer Jonathan Ive, this year's gala saw designers show off their innovative creations on 'muses' including Madonna, Kendall Jenner, Emma Watson and Jourdan Dunn.

Pop superstar Beyoncé made the most impact on the red carpeted steps, following the release of her much-talked about new album Lemonade.

While most guests opted for silver, metallic outfits, the singer wore a nude latex Givenchy gown, arriving without husband Jay Z on her arm.

Swift also decided to go solo, wearing a custom-made Louis Vuitton skater-style cut out dress.

As usual, all eyes were on reality star Kardashian and husband Kanye West when they arrived at the event.

The Keeping Up With the Kardashians star predictably wore a metallic Balmain gown while rapper West bucked the tuxedo trend and opted for a rather casual combination of ripped jeans and a T-shirt.

Kardashian's supermodel sister Jenner wore a Versace cut-out dress and posed next to modelling icon Cindy Crawford on the red carpet ahead of the dinner.

Her reality star sister Kylie Jenner made her Met Ball debut in a silver Balmain outfit.

Model of the moment Gigi Hadid arrived with her former One Direction star boyfriend Zayn Malik., making their first ever red carpet appearance together as a couple.

Madonna was clearly out to make a big impact, leaving very little to the imagination in a sheer bondage-themed ensemble designed by Riccardo Tisci.

Keeping up the British contingent at annual event was Emma Watson, who wore classic Calvin Klein wide-legged trousers and an off the shoulder top.

Model Poppy Delevingne, Sienna Miller, Rosie Huntington-Whiteley, Jourdan Dunn and Alexa Chung also put in stylish appearances at the biggest event in the fashion calendar.
